EVG ETF Overview
EVG ETF (Eaton Vance Short Duration Diversified Income Fund) is managed by Eaton Vance with $442.0M in net assets. EVG expense ratio is 1.35%, holding 740 positions across sectors including Financials, Industrials, Consumer Discretionary. Inception date: 2005-02-28.
EVG performance shows a YTD return of 2.06%. The 1-year return is 6.59% and the 5-year return is 5.13%. EVG dividend yield stands at 8.05%, paid monthly.
EVG top holdings include Morgan Stanley Institutional Liquidity Funds - Government Portfolio - Institutional Class (5.1%), Uniform Mortgage-Backed Security, Tba (4.8%), Commercial Mortgage Trust, Series 2013-cr11, Class D (1.4%), Government National Mortgage Association (1.4%), Freddie Mac Remics (1.4%).
